Maizuru Park

Maizuru Park, nestled amidst the ruins of Fukuoka Castle and Korokan Ruins Museum, boasts a wealth of cherry trees amidst its historic setting, offering visitors the opportunity to climb into the citadel for panoramic views of Fukuoka Tower and Yahuoku Dome by the seaside. Additionally, the park features various sports grounds and amenities, making it a popular destination for families and children. Maizuru Park provides a tranquil escape just 15 minutes from the bustling hub of Tenjin, offering visitors a delightful blend of natural beauty and cultural heritage throughout the year.

Nishi Park

Nishi Park boasts approximately 1,300 cherry trees that burst into bloom during hanami season, starting in late March. Formerly known as “Aratsuyama,” this scenic park offers panoramic vistas of Fukuoka City, Hakata Bay and Shikanoshima Island from its sprawling 170,000 square meter expanse extending into Hakata Bay. Established in 1881, the park’s natural hills and valleys were transformed into a picturesque landscape adorned with cherry trees, azaleas and a variety of trees including pine, beech and evergreen oak. Recognized as one of Japan’s Top 100 Cherry Blossom Viewing Sites, it serves as a tranquil oasis for Fukuoka Prefecture residents, offering serene walking paths amidst the bustling city. Additionally, visitors can enjoy evening illuminations and delicious street food from stalls.

Atago Shrine

Adorned with hundreds of cherry trees along its steep approach and hilltop location, Atago Shrine offers a breathtaking sight, especially when illuminated in the evenings. As visitors ascend the staircases in early spring, they are greeted by the vibrant blooms of over 2,000 cherry trees, ranging from the early blooming Kawazuzakura to the later blooming Yaezakura varieties. Established in the year 72, Atago Shrine holds the distinction of being the oldest shrine in Fukuoka and is revered as one of Japan’s three major shrines with the same name. Renowned for its auspicious cherry blossoms, the shrine’s trees are believed to bring happiness to those who behold them. Set atop Mount Atago, a 68-meter hill, visitors can enjoy panoramic views of the city while marveling at the beauty of the cherry blossoms. In the evenings, the illuminated cherry blossoms complement the shrine’s enchanting ambiance, creating an unforgettable experience for visitors.

Uminonakamichi Seaside Park

Uminonakamichi Seaside Park, situated on a lengthy peninsula just north of central Fukuoka, boasts a vast expanse adorned with approximately 2,000 cherry trees. This expansive park caters to visitors of all ages, offering many attractions ranging from sprawling flower gardens and recreational areas to a zoo and water park. Highlighted by 1.5 million light blue nemophilia flowers and 1,600 cherry blossoms in spring, the park’s sheer size makes renting bicycles, available for 500 yen for three hours, the preferred mode of exploration. With its extensive cycling trails and shuttle bus service, the park ensures easy access to its diverse attractions, ensuring a memorable experience for couples, families and friends alike.
